blob: 470627d5cd19990af36549fa77dfe9eeb258506b [file] [log] [blame]
{ "type": "class",
"qname": "mx.resources.Locale",
"baseClassname": ""
,
"description": "The Locale class can be used to parse a locale String such as <code>&quot;en_US_MAC&quot;</code> into its three parts: a language code, a country code, and a variant. <p>The localization APIs in the IResourceManager and IResourceBundle interfaces use locale Strings rather than Locale instances, so this class is seldom used in an application.</p>",
"tags": [
{ "tagName": "see",
"values": ["mx.resources.IResourceBundle", "mx.resources.IResourceManager"]},
{ "tagName": "playerversion",
"values": ["Flash 9", "AIR 1.1"]},
{ "tagName": "productversion",
"values": ["Flex 3"]},
{ "tagName": "langversion",
"values": ["3.0"]} ],
"members": [
{ "type": "method",
"qname": "mx.resources.Locale",
"namespace": "",
"bindable": [],
"details": [],
"deprecated": {},
"description": "Constructor. such as <code>&quot;en&quot;</code>, <code>&quot;en_US&quot;</code>, or <code>&quot;en_US_MAC&quot;</code>. The parts are separated by underscore characters. The first part is a two-letter lowercase language code as defined by ISO-639, such as <code>&quot;en&quot;</code> for English. The second part is a two-letter uppercase country code as defined by ISO-3166, such as <code>&quot;US&quot;</code> for the United States. The third part is a variant String, which can be used to optionally distinguish multiple locales for the same language and country. It is sometimes used to indicate the operating system that the locale should be used with, such as <code>&quot;MAC&quot;</code>, <code>&quot;WIN&quot;</code>, or <code>&quot;UNIX&quot;</code>.",
"tags": [
{ "tagName": "param",
"values": ["localeString A 1-, 2-, or 3-part locale String,"]},
{ "tagName": "playerversion",
"values": ["Flash 9", "AIR 1.1"]},
{ "tagName": "productversion",
"values": ["Flex 3"]},
{ "tagName": "langversion",
"values": ["3.0"]} ],
"return": "",
"params": [{ "name": "localeString", "type": "String"}]}
,
{ "type": "accessor",
"access": "read-only",
"return": "String",
"qname": "language",
"namespace": "public",
"bindable": [],
"details": [],
"deprecated": {},
"description": "The language code of this Locale instance. [Read-Only] <pre>\\n var locale:Locale = new Locale(&quot;en_US_MAC&quot;);\\n trace(locale.language); // outputs &quot;en&quot;\\n </pre>",
"tags": [
{ "tagName": "playerversion",
"values": ["Flash 9", "AIR 1.1"]},
{ "tagName": "productversion",
"values": ["Flex 3"]},
{ "tagName": "langversion",
"values": ["3.0"]} ]},
{ "type": "accessor",
"access": "read-only",
"return": "String",
"qname": "country",
"namespace": "public",
"bindable": [],
"details": [],
"deprecated": {},
"description": "The country code of this Locale instance. [Read-Only] <pre>\\n var locale:Locale = new Locale(&quot;en_US_MAC&quot;);\\n trace(locale.country); // outputs &quot;US&quot;\\n </pre>",
"tags": [
{ "tagName": "playerversion",
"values": ["Flash 9", "AIR 1.1"]},
{ "tagName": "productversion",
"values": ["Flex 3"]},
{ "tagName": "langversion",
"values": ["3.0"]} ]},
{ "type": "accessor",
"access": "read-only",
"return": "String",
"qname": "variant",
"namespace": "public",
"bindable": [],
"details": [],
"deprecated": {},
"description": "The variant part of this Locale instance. [Read-Only] <pre>\\n var locale:Locale = new Locale(&quot;en_US_MAC&quot;);\\n trace(locale.variant); // outputs &quot;MAC&quot;\\n </pre>",
"tags": [
{ "tagName": "playerversion",
"values": ["Flash 9", "AIR 1.1"]},
{ "tagName": "productversion",
"values": ["Flex 3"]},
{ "tagName": "langversion",
"values": ["3.0"]} ]},
{ "type": "method",
"qname": "toString",
"namespace": "public",
"bindable": [],
"details": [],
"deprecated": {},
"description": "Returns the locale String that was used to construct this Locale instance. For example: <pre>\\n var locale:Locale = new Locale(&quot;en_US_MAC&quot;);\\n trace(locale.toString()); // outputs &quot;en_US_MAC&quot;\\n </pre> construct this Locale instance.",
"tags": [
{ "tagName": "playerversion",
"values": ["Flash 9", "AIR 1.1"]},
{ "tagName": "productversion",
"values": ["Flex 3"]},
{ "tagName": "return",
"values": ["Returns the locale String that was used to"]},
{ "tagName": "langversion",
"values": ["3.0"]} ],
"return": "String",
"params": []}
]
}